Summary: CNY Fertility is a renowned fertility center offering advanced treatments like IVF, IUI, and egg freezing. With a patient-centered approach and cutting-edge technology, we support individuals and couples on their journey to parenthood. We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Medical Billing Coder to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for accurately assigning appropriate medical codes to diagnoses and procedures for reimbursement purposes. The Medical Billing Coder will work closely with healthcare providers, billing specialists, and insurance companies to ensure timely and accurate billing processes.

Required Duties and Responsibilities: Include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Assign appropriate medical codes to diagnoses and procedures according to coding guidelines and regulations (ICD-10, CPT, HCPCS).
  • Review medical records and documentation to ensure accurate code assignment.
  • Communicate with healthcare providers to clarify documentation and coding discrepancies.
  • Collaborate with billing specialists to submit clean claims and resolve coding-related denials.
  • Stay up-to-date on changes in coding guidelines, regulations, and payer policies.
  • Participate in coding audits and compliance reviews as needed.
  • Maintain confidentiality of patient information and comply with HIPAA regulations.
  • Provide coding expertise and support to other members of the billing team.

Knowledge, Skills and Other Abilities:

  • Strong understanding of medical terminology, anatomy, and physiology.
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y in coding assignments.
  • Ability to work independently and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ency in using coding software and electronic health records (EHR) systems.
  • Commitment to maintaining coding accuracy and compliance with regulatory requirements.

Certificates and Licenses:

  • Certification as a Certified Professional Coder (CPC) or Certified Coding Specialist (CCS)聽required.
